Transaction 21c71d38e004d07d0c1186e06084fc41ecf32b95041a3c9682b115fc0dc4ce23

1 Input
2 Outputs
  • 21c71d38e004d07d0c1186e06084fc41ecf32b95041a3c9682b115fc0dc4ce23:0
  • value  10843200
    address  1DWPhCaFkew1gJEZGXNx3iJzqHpEGxQBq5
  • 21c71d38e004d07d0c1186e06084fc41ecf32b95041a3c9682b115fc0dc4ce23:1
  • value  64693554
    address  16vs2nd7XyLRWqqwv3JngzpUQmpKkQHeUQ